Sara Jodka was recently quoted in the Bloomberg Law article, “States Ramp Up Car Privacy Enforcement Using Tricks Old and New.” The article highlights the growing scrutiny facing the automotive industry’s data practices and the actions some states have taken in response. Jodka states, “As these new consumer privacy laws come on the books, you will see states enforcing not only through the old method of, getting privacy compliance through consumer business laws, you’ll also now start seeing it in the privacy laws.” To read more, click here.
